Watermelon Mint Lemonade

Serves: 2 servings
 
Frozen watermelon blended with freshly squeezed lemon juice and mint simple syrup. This watermelon mint lemonade is refreshing and perfect for the summer heat.
Ingredients
Mint Simple Syrup
  • ¼ cup granulated sugar
  • ¼ cup water
  • ¼ cup mint
Watermelon Lemonade
  • 2 cups frozen cubed watermelon
  • ¾ cup water
  • Juice of two lemons
Directions:
  1. Place cubed watermelons in a freezable bag or container in the freezer for several hours or overnight until they are frozen. I like to keep cubed watermelon in the freezer just in case I need them for anything.
  2. In a small pot, add water, mint leaves, and granulated sugar. Cook over low heat for about 5 minutes. Remove the pot from heat and let the mint leaves steep for several minutes. The longer the mint leaves steep, the stronger the flavor. Remove the mint leaves and set the mint simple syrup aside for now.
  3. Add frozen cubed watermelon into a food processor or a high speed blender. Add water, lemon juice, and mint simple syrup. Blend until the watermelon becomes a frozen slushie consistency.
  4. Serve the watermelon mint lemonade cold immediately.
